Evaluation for neurotoxicity of oxaliplatin using Nerve Conduction Velocity

Conditions

colorectal cancer

Interventions

1.Nerve Conduction Velocity 2.tuning fork

Inclusion criteria

Inclusion criteria: 1) Histologically confirmed colorectal cancer 2) No prior L-OHP administration 3) No peripheral neuropathy 4) Voluntary written informed consent

Exclusion criteria

Exclusion criteria: Metastasis to the CNS

Design outcomes

Primary

MeasureTime frame
1. Collation between NCV and oxaliplatin induced neurotoxicity 2. Collation between tuning fork and oxaliplatin induced neurotoxicity 3. Analyze the mechanism of oxaliplatin induced neurotoxicity
